Tragedy in Portugal: British Family Killed in Devastating Road Crash
British family killed in Portugal road crash

A British family of four has been killed in a devastating road accident while on holiday in Portugal, authorities have confirmed. The tragic incident occurred near the town of Mealhada, leaving the local community and relatives back in the UK in deep mourning.

The victims, who have not yet been formally identified, are believed to be two adults and two children. Emergency services rushed to the scene after the collision, but sadly all four were pronounced dead at the scene.

Details of the Tragic Accident

According to local reports, the accident happened when the family's vehicle was involved in a collision with another car. Portuguese police are currently investigating the exact circumstances of the crash.

Witnesses described a scene of utter devastation at the crash site, with emergency workers struggling to free the victims from the wreckage. The road was closed for several hours as investigators examined the scene.

Foreign Office Assistance

The British Foreign Office has confirmed it is providing support to the family of those who died. A spokesperson said: "We are supporting the family of a British family who died in Portugal and are in contact with the local authorities."
